Web3 Jan 2024 · Scotland’s Court of Session will hold a substantive hearing on the country's deposit return scheme (DRS) after a judicial review case was allowed to proceed. The highest civil court granted permission for the case to move forward on 23 December, with the date for the first substantive hearing set for 30 March. Web28 Mar 2024 · The company running Scotland’s Deposit Return Scheme (DRS) initially suggested a later start date to ministers. David Harris, chief executive of Circularity Scotland, told MSPs there is a “great deal to do” before the initiative is due to come into force on 16 August, but insisted the not-for-profit body is “working round the clock to deliver”.
